Transaction dc2607693c6519742c1262e6912c4948c5fbe171c10be41c1d76a74364223fbc
1 Input
1 Output
-
dc2607693c6519742c1262e6912c4948c5fbe171c10be41c1d76a74364223fbc:0
- value
- 704390
- script pubkey
- OP_0 OP_PUSHBYTES_32 05fab786df8fe5486b8facbc6d8398eecf40754691058a4d960c5a096931e9de
- address
- bc1qqhat0pkl3lj5s6u04j7xmqucam85qa2xjyzc5nvkp3dqj6f3a80qv67eyy